JavaScript WebAPI File File.size Property
The JavaScript File WebAPI file.size property returns the size of file in bytes.
Following is the code for the File WebApi File.size property −
Example
<!DOCTYPE html> <html lang="en"> <head> <meta charset="UTF-8" /> <me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width, initial-scale=1.0" /> <title>Document</title> <style> body { font-family: "Segoe UI", Tahoma, Geneva, Verdana, sans-serif; } .result { font-size: 18px; font-weight: 500; color: red; } </style> </head> <body> <h1>JavaScript file.size property</h1> <div class="result"></div> <input type="file" class="fileInput" /> <h3> Upload a file using the above input type to get its file size </h3> <script> let resultEle = document.querySelector(".result"); document .querySelector(".fileInput") .addEventListener("change", (event) => { resultEle.innerHTML += "File name = " + event.target.files[0].name + ‘<br>; resultEle.innerHTML += "File size = " + event.target.files[0].size + ' bytes '; }); </script> </body> </html>
Output
On clicking the ‘Choose file’ button and selecting a file −
